The demand for heterogeneous architectures continues to rise, driven by the exponential growth in generative AI and accelerated computing. Workloads are being spread across new and diverse hardware, such as GPUs, NPUs, and AI accelerators, allowing traditional algorithms and new neural networks to run much faster than possible. The challenge we face is ensuring a standards-based way to target hardware with multiple types of processors from different vendors. The UXL Foundation is at the heart of making this a reality with a core set of standards-based and open-source projects, but we still need to do more.

This session brings together experts from the hardware and software community to discuss the strengths of open standards and open-source software and how everyone wins when collaborating towards the same goals.
